    Last summer I took my boys to some story times and some festivals, they were 2.5 almost 3. At the story times they would cling to me and at the festivals they would want to go on the rides but as soon as they got in they would get right back out and come running to me. In other words they were VERY shy. I decided to call around to some of the preschools just to see what was offered and found a great program for 2.5 year olds that was geared toward social skills. They talked me into it even though I was going to wait until the following year.

    Well fast forward to today's preschool graduation ceremony. I dropped them off with the class expecting a complete meltdown by one or both since there were so many kids there. Well they were fine, in fact they were great. They stayed with the class, walked out into the gym, and sang their song in front of a huge room full of people. And they even went and sang the closing song with all the preschool kids. In fact, Michael raced to the back row with the rest of the kids and Matthew sat down right next to the teacher facing all the other kids and helped her direct the final song.

    It was really awesome to see. I know the complete change isn't soley due to the preschool since 9 months makes a big difference but......I gotta believe it didn't hurt!

    I am soooo proud of my little guys and they have so much more confidence. In fact, more than once I've heard them say..."See mom, I'm not shy no more."
